Introduction to the Team As part of the Machine Learning Science organization at Expedia Group, you’ll help build a scalable, intelligent pricing system that directly shapes how we balance volume and profitability across multiple lines of business. The decisions this system drives influence billions of dollars in revenue and are visible at the highest levels of the company.
In this role, you will:
Design, build, and improve ML models and systems that power Expedia Group products, with a focus on measurable business and customer impact.
Perform end‑to‑end model development, including problem formulation, data exploration, feature engineering, training, evaluation, and deployment in production environments.
Develop robust data pipelines, data transformations, and data quality checks to ensure high‑quality input signals for ML models and experimentation.
Partner with product, engineering, and analytics teams to translate business problems into ML solutions, define success metrics, and run experiments to validate impact.
Safely integrate and operate AI/ML‑enabled solutions that improve outcomes, including familiarity with AI‑driven systems, tools, or workflows and applying AI/ML concepts to real‑world products.
Contribute to system design (including model‑serving APIs and supporting data models), documentation, and best practices that enable reuse and scalability across multiple product domains.
Minimum Qualifications: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, or a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ience.
Professional experience as a Machine Learning Scientist or in a similar applied ML role, working on end‑to‑end model development and deployment in real‑world products.
Proficiency in at least one programming language commonly used for ML (such as Python) and experience working with data processing frameworks, model training libraries, and model evaluation techniques.
Experience owning ML components or services in production, including monitoring model performance, maintaining data pipelines, and collaborating with engineering teams on APIs and data models.
Preferred Qualifications:
Advanced degree (master’s or PhD) in a quantitative discipline (e.g., Engineering, Statistics, Economics, or related fields).
Experience working on pricing, revenue optimization, marketplace dynamics, or similar business problems.
Experience designing and analyzing experiments (e.g., A/B testing) and working with noisy or incomplete data.
Experience building ML models using user behavior, segmentation, or contextual signals.
Familiarity with causal inference methods or optimization techniques (e.g., mixed‑integer programming) in applied settings.
